#ddc569 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ddc569 is composed of 86.7% red, 77.3%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.9% magenta, 52.5%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 47.6 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 63.9%. #ddc569 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#bb8b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#ddc569
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0802 is the darkest color, while #fefd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ddc569
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a4a2 is the less saturated color, while #f9d64d is the most saturated one.
